What is a Dosing Pump?

Dosing pumps are specialized devices designed to accurately dispense fluids at specific flow rates, essential in a variety of applications. These might include adding flavors to foods, disinfecting water, or introducing chemicals into an industrial process. Their precision makes them ideal for tasks where consistency is crucial. By using a dosing pump, industries can ensure the right amount of fluid is released, reducing waste and improving product quality.

How Do Dosing Pumps Work?

The operation of a dosing pump is straightforward yet sophisticated. It uses a motor to drive a pump head that pushes a precise volume of liquid from a reservoir. You can set these pumps to dispense fluids continuously or in set quantities at timed intervals. This versatility allows them to suit various needs, from healthcare to agriculture. Applications of Dosing Pumps

Dosing pumps are used across many sectors. In agriculture, they help in delivering fertilizers and pesticides accurately, enhancing crop yields. In the healthcare field, they ensure precise delivery of medications, crucial for patient safety. Water treatment industries rely on them for adding specific chemicals to purify water. This flexibility and precision make them indispensable in improving processes and outcomes.

Benefits of Using Dosing Pumps

The main advantage of dosing pumps is their precision, which reduces waste and cost. By delivering exact amounts, they help maintain consistency in product quality. Additionally, they are reliable and can operate continuously without significant downtime, making them particularly valuable in settings that demand round-the-clock operations. Choosing the Right Dosing Pump

Selecting the correct dosing pump involves understanding your specific requirements, including the type of fluid, required flow rate, and pressure. It's important to match pump capabilities with these factors to ensure efficient operation. Maintaining Your Dosing Pump

Regular maintenance is crucial for the long-term efficiency of dosing pumps. Routine checks and cleaning are necessary to prevent clogs and ensure the pump runs smoothly. Replacing parts like seals and diaphragms periodically can extend the pump's life. Establishing a maintenance schedule will help avoid unexpected failures and costly downtimes.

Frequently Asked Questions

1. What industries commonly use dosing pumps?

Answer: Dosing pumps are widely used in industries such as food and beverage, pharmaceuticals, agriculture, and water treatment for their precision in fluid handling.

2. Are dosing pumps easy to install?

Answer: Yes, most dosing pumps come with straightforward installation guides. However, for complex systems, professional installation might be recommended to ensure optimal performance.

3. How do I determine the correct pump size for my needs?

Answer: To select the correct size, consider the type of fluid, required flow rate, and system pressure. Consulting with a manufacturer or using resources from industry experts can help in making the right choice.

4. How often should a dosing pump be maintained?

Answer: Regular maintenance should be done according to the manufacturer's guidelines, typically ranging from monthly checks to yearly part replacements, based on usage intensity.

5. Can dosing pumps handle all types of fluids?

Answer: While dosing pumps are versatile, some models are designed for specific types of fluids (e.g., corrosive, viscous, or particulate-laden). It's essential to choose a pump that matches the properties of the fluid in use.
